    It really is great. I'm trying to decide how to run my 2k Franchise. I want to do an expansion team for sure.

    Maybe I'm getting old but playing an hour plus Madden franchise game is brutal at times. The last 2K I bought I kicked around an idea of only playing the last 6 minutes of each regular season game (that isn't a blow out) but it didn't stick. There are a couple reason I wanted to use this method: 1) An article came out that basically said only the last 6 minutes of an NBA game matter (from a statical/gambling perspective). 2) To shorten the season and game lengths drastically. I think I may try this method again this year. I want to be able to have meaningful input throughout the season and stay connected to the league but I also want to play through a bunch of seasons too (even more so with draft classes). Hopefully this will be a good balance. I'd also play every playoff game for my team.

    Anyway, interested how others play through their MyLeague.


    I use player lock. I use create a player to mimic my career. Play PG 91 ovr (my last my career player from 2k14). Use advance rotation to play 33-36 mins a night so I get subbed in/out accordingly. Play a 29 game seasons at 12 min quarters. Playoffs format 3-5-5-7. Build a franchise around my character. This year im thinking of going with either Cle, Orl, or NYK. Not sure yet. But I do wish we had yr to yr save so I can go from playing 3-4 season to 15+.

      I like controlling only one team but I HATE the players complaining about playing time in MYGM and I don't care for the goals so I go with MyLeague instead that way I can play whatever rotation I want. I also turn off trades and build through the draft.

      I always play the first game of the season, Christmas Day game (or game directly after Christmas day), the game after the all-star break, and the last game of the season. If I make the playoffs I always play deciding games. This leads to me playing 4 to a possible 20 games per season depending on how the whole playoff situation goes. I'm excited for the tournament amongst the non-playoff teams because it means that if I don't make the playoffs there's still something to fight for.

      This is pretty much how I have to do it to get through multiple seasons as I don't have the time to play like I did as a kid.
